#d6bc66 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6bc66 is composed of 83.9% red, 73.7%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.1% magenta, 52.3%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 46.1 degrees, a saturation of 57.7% and a lightness of 62%. #d6bc66 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ffcc with #ad7900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

● #d6bc66 color description : Moderate yellow.
#d6bc66 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6bc66 has RGB values of R:214, G:188,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.52,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14072934.

Shades and Tints of #d6bc66
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fbf9f1 is the lightest one.
